UEFA president slams Super League clubs for kickstarting "nonsense" plans during war
UEFA chief Aleksander Ceferin has blasted rebel clubs Barcelona, Real Madrid and Juventus for plotting a fresh attempt of the breakaway European Super League. The Slovenian President, 54, has slammed the European giants in a scathing assessment that they are 'planning to launch another idea now in the middle of a war.' 'I’m sick and tired of speaking of this non-football project,' said Ceferin. 'Look, first they launched their nonsense of an idea in the middle of a pandemic; now we’re reading articles every day that they are planning to launch another idea now in the middle of a war. 'Do I have to speak more about those people? They obviously live in a parallel world. UEFA President...
